Position Summary:
Primarily responsible for providing administrative assistance to assigned Community Manager which includes customer service, completing compliance inspections and overall administrative duties that lead to the success of on-going projects as well as for ensuring Architectural Guidelines and Governing Documents are upheld within designated communities by thorough knowledge of CC&Rs and Design Guidelines. Providing both customer service and education to homeowners in respect to compliance and submittal processes to ensure the overall success of the community.
Position Responsibilities
- Process resident applications to the Architectural Review Committee (ARC), including but not limited to screening submittals for missing information, coordinating application process with Community Manager and/or ARC, preparing approval / denial letters to applicant(s) and drafting monthly ARC Review reporting to the Board of Directors.
 - Maintain an organized filing and tracking system for Architectural Review Committee submittals.
 - Educate residents on the ARC submittal process and compliance administration.
 - Attend monthly Architectural Review Committee meetings. Track all submission status, committee questions and responses and all related correspondence and communication.
 - Conduct weekly physical inspections of community to ensure compliance of Association’s Governing Documents and Design Guidelines.
 - Research, record and track compliance information through company database.
 - Investigate third-party non-compliance reports, maintain detailed records of non-compliance issue investigations and follow-up.
 - Oversee preparation of compliance notices, fine notices and related correspondence.
 - Work effectively and respectfully with co-workers, customers and vendors, keeping commitments and others informed of work progress, timetables, issues, and collaborating to find mutually acceptable and practical solutions.
 - Attend monthly Board of Directors meetings. Support meeting setup, draft meeting minutes, record and post meeting videos and other documents to website as needed.
 - Provide direct administrative support and other organizational and communication tasks as directed by the Community Manager in order to meet community standards.
 - Draft Board Resolution documents, community e-blasts, and other correspondence as directed by the Community Manager.
 - Extend top-notch customer service and problem resolution via phone and face-to-face interaction with residents and staff.
 - Performs other related duties as directed.
